Implement Page bundling and image handling
This commit is not the smallest in Hugo's history.

Some hightlights include:

* Page bundles (for complete articles, keeping images and content together etc.).
* Bundled images can be processed in as many versions/sizes as you need with the three methods `Resize`, `Fill` and `Fit`.
* Processed images are cached inside `resources/_gen/images` (default) in your project.
* Symbolic links (both files and dirs) are now allowed anywhere inside /content
* A new table based build summary
* The "Total in nn ms" now reports the total including the handling of the files inside /static. So if it now reports more than you're used to, it is just **more real** and probably faster than before (see below).

A site building  benchmark run compared to `v0.31.1` shows that this should be slightly faster and use less memory:

package commands
import (
"bytes"
"errors"
"os"
"time"
"github.com/gohugoio/hugo/parser"
"github.com/spf13/cobra"
)
var undraftCmd = &cobra.Command{
Use: "undraft path/to/content",
Short: "Undraft resets the content's draft status",
Long: `Undraft resets the content's draft status
and updates the date to the current date and time.
If the content's draft status is 'False', nothing is done.`,
RunE: Undraft,
}
// Undraft publishes the specified content by setting its draft status
// to false and setting its publish date to now. If the specified content is
// not a draft, it will log an error.
func Undraft(cmd *cobra.Command, args []string) error {
c, err := InitializeConfig(false, nil)
if err != nil {
return err
}
if len(args) < 1 {
return newUserError("a piece of content needs to be specified")
}
cfg := c.DepsCfg
location := args[0]
// open the file
f, err := cfg.Fs.Source.Open(location)
if err != nil {
return err
}
// get the page from file
p, err := parser.ReadFrom(f)
f.Close()
if err != nil {
return err
}
w, err := undraftContent(p)
if err != nil {
return newSystemErrorF("an error occurred while undrafting %q: %s", location, err)
}
f, err = cfg.Fs.Source.OpenFile(location, os.O_WRONLY|os.O_TRUNC, 0644)
if err != nil {
return newSystemErrorF("%q not be undrafted due to error opening file to save changes: %q\n", location, err)
}
defer f.Close()
_, err = w.WriteTo(f)
if err != nil {
return newSystemErrorF("%q not be undrafted due to save error: %q\n", location, err)
}
return nil
}
// undraftContent: if the content is a draft, change its draft status to
// 'false' and set the date to time.Now(). If the draft status is already
// 'false', don't do anything.
func undraftContent(p parser.Page) (bytes.Buffer, error) {
var buff bytes.Buffer
// get the metadata; easiest way to see if it's a draft
meta, err := p.Metadata()
if err != nil {
return buff, err
}
// since the metadata was obtainable, we can also get the key/value separator for
// Front Matter
fm := p.FrontMatter()
if fm == nil {
return buff, errors.New("Front Matter was found, nothing was finalized")
}
var isDraft, gotDate bool
var date string
L:
for k, v := range meta.(map[string]interface{}) {
switch k {
case "draft":
if !v.(bool) {
return buff, errors.New("not a Draft: nothing was done")
}
isDraft = true
if gotDate {
break L
}
case "date":
date = v.(string) // capture the value to make replacement easier
gotDate = true
if isDraft {
break L
}
}
}
// if draft wasn't found in FrontMatter, it isn't a draft.
if !isDraft {
return buff, errors.New("not a Draft: nothing was done")
}
// get the front matter as bytes and split it into lines
var lineEnding []byte
fmLines := bytes.Split(fm, []byte("\n"))
if len(fmLines) == 1 { // if the result is only 1 element, try to split on dos line endings
fmLines = bytes.Split(fm, []byte("\r\n"))
if len(fmLines) == 1 {
return buff, errors.New("unable to split FrontMatter into lines")
}
lineEnding = append(lineEnding, []byte("\r\n")...)
} else {
lineEnding = append(lineEnding, []byte("\n")...)
}
// Write the front matter lines to the buffer, replacing as necessary
for _, v := range fmLines {
pos := bytes.Index(v, []byte("draft"))
if pos != -1 {
continue
}
pos = bytes.Index(v, []byte("date"))
if pos != -1 { // if date field wasn't found, add it
v = bytes.Replace(v, []byte(date), []byte(time.Now().Format(time.RFC3339)), 1)
}
buff.Write(v)
buff.Write(lineEnding)
}
// append the actual content
buff.Write(p.Content())
return buff, nil
}
